Transaction feb4813b67c5d6879fdfbd495a5488d598cd0b9b36d7c4614a25c39dea5622c2

block
76cc80013230717a71ae9d03476e9ab018e659c92e312c56454cba4663acd109

10 Inputs

34 Outputs